Output d95ccadfd56ff4cd229386989664e446c2e4b76aa0aa28455bd1510ade13e880:0

value
3594800030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2c0d447e583bc953a14b6d35e141f7d53242e8f OP_EQUAL
address
MUa7wnxDpmz9eCAPZWhMZawjzW8DNcu4Bm
transaction
d95ccadfd56ff4cd229386989664e446c2e4b76aa0aa28455bd1510ade13e880
spent
true